1Definition

Autonomous Site Robotics refers to the deployment of robots in unstructured construction environments for tasks such as site layout and bricklaying. These systems leverage advanced robotics technologies to navigate complex sites autonomously.

4How It Works

These robots use Simultaneous Localization and Mapping (SLAM) technology to build a map of their surroundings while keeping track of their position within it. They also integrate Building Information Modeling (BIM) data for precise task execution. Heavy-duty robotic arms are used to perform tasks like bricklaying.

14Glossary
SLAM
Simultaneous Localization and Mapping, a technology that allows robots to build maps of their environment while keeping track of their position within it.
BIM
Building Information Modeling, a process for creating and managing digital representations of physical and functional characteristics of buildings.
